OREANDA-NEWS. December 27, 2010. St. Petersburg construction industry is coming to the pre-crisis level; industrial growth has first been demonstrated in 2010. The year has brought many important changes: construction industry has become self-regulated, important changes have been made in the legislation base, several large objects have been put into operation and new ones already launched. These facts were announced by Roman Filimonov, St. Petersburg Vice-Governor and the president of Construction Associations Union, in regards with the forthcoming VIII Constructors Conference,   which will open today in “Lenexpo” exhibition and congress center.

The conference will become the place to sum up results, discuss field goals, search for efficient solutions and set up new aims. Sergey Petrov, the first deputy chairman of State Duma Construction Committee, will talk about new legislative construction and self-regulation initiatives. Alexander Vakhmistrov, the first Vice-President of the National Association, chairman of the Public Council working with self-regulated construction enterprises, director general and chairman of the board of “LSR Group” Ltd, will talk about the National Association of self-regulated enterprises.

The Forum is also regarded as the annual meeting of the Construction Associations Union’s members where they will sum up the results and work out new plans for the season of 2011.
